1. Enhanced Air Intake Systems

A great engine needs to breathe freely. The factory air intake system on your R-Class is designed for quiet operation and filtration, but it can also be a bottleneck for airflow, especially when seeking more power. Upgrading the intake system can allow more cold, dense air into the engine, which is crucial for combustion.

 

What it does: Replaces restrictive air filters and intake tubing with less constrictive, often larger diameter, components. This can also give your R-Class a more aggressive intake sound under acceleration.


Benefits:
Improved throttle response.
Slight increase in horsepower and torque, especially noticeable at higher RPMs.
More pronounced induction sound.


Types of Upgrades:

High-Flow Air Filters: A simple swap for your stock paper filter with a less restrictive, reusable filter (like K&N or BMC).


Cold Air Intake (CAI) Kits: These kits typically include a new airbox, a high-flow filter, and usually a smoother, larger diameter intake tube that routes the filter to a cooler air source, often away from the engine bay heat for denser air.

Beginner Friendliness: High-flow filters are extremely beginner-friendly, often a direct drop-in replacement. CAI kits are also relatively straightforward but may require removing a few more factory components.


Recommended Brands: K&N Engineering, AFE Power, BMC Air Filters.

2. Performance Exhaust Systems

Similar to intake, the exhaust system is designed to efficiently remove spent gases from the engine. However, factory exhausts often include resonators and catalytic converters that can muffle sound and restrict flow. A performance exhaust system can improve this.

 

What it does: Replaces the stock exhaust components with larger diameter pipes, less restrictive mufflers, and often high-flow catalytic converters or cat-delete pipes (ensure local regulations allow for this).


Benefits:
Reduced backpressure, allowing the engine to exhale more freely.
Noticeable gains in horsepower and torque.
A more aggressive and resonant exhaust note, enhancing the driving experience.
Aesthetics: Many performance exhausts feature larger, polished tips.


Types of Upgrades:


Cat-Back Systems: These replace everything from the catalytic converter(s) back to the tailpipes. They are generally the most popular choice for balancing performance, sound, and legality.

Axle-Back Systems: Only replaces the mufflers and tips. Offers a sound change and minimal performance gain but is often more affordable and easier to install.


Headers/Exhaust Manifolds: Replaces the factory manifolds with more efficient designs. This is a more advanced modification that can yield significant gains but is also more complex and costly.

Beginner Friendliness: Axle-back systems are the easiest. Cat-back systems are moderately difficult, often requiring jack stands and basic mechanical skills. Headers are typically for advanced DIYers or professional installation.


Considerations: Local emissions regulations are crucial. Cat-delete pipes are illegal in many regions. The sound volume can be significant, so consider your neighbors and local noise ordinances. 3. ECU Tuning (Engine Control Unit Remapping)

This is where you can unlock significant, refined power gains. Modern engines are managed by a sophisticated computer, the ECU. “Tuning” or “remapping” involves reprogramming this computer to optimize engine parameters like fuel delivery, ignition timing, and boost pressure (for turbocharged engines).

 

What it does: Adjusts the engine’s operating parameters to take advantage of improved airflow from intake and exhaust upgrades, or to simply extract more power from the stock hardware within safe limits.


Benefits:
Substantial gains in horsepower and torque, often across the entire RPM range.
Improved throttle response and smoother power delivery.
Can optimize fuel efficiency if programmed for it (though performance tunes usually prioritize power).
Can often be tailored to specific modifications on the vehicle.


Types of Tuning:


Handheld Tuners/Programmers: Devices that plug into your OBD-II port to upload new software maps. Many allow you to switch between different maps (e.g., stock, performance, economy) and sometimes adjust certain parameters yourself.

Bench Tuning/ECU Send-in: The ECU is removed from the vehicle and sent to a tuner for reprogramming on a specialized bench. This allows for more in-depth and custom modifications.


Professional Dyno Tuning: The most advanced and recommended method for custom tuning. The vehicle is run on a dynamometer (a machine that measures power output) while a tuner makes real-time adjustments to the ECU software. This ensures the tune is perfectly optimized for your specific vehicle and modifications.

Beginner Friendliness: Handheld tuners are the most accessible for beginners. Professional dyno tuning is recommended for serious performance gains and safety but requires professional expertise.

4. Turbocharger and Supercharger Upgrades

For many R-Class models, especially those with V6 or V8 engines, the factory turbochargers are a primary target for significant power increases. While a full turbo upgrade is a more involved process, it offers the most drastic performance potential.

 

What it does: Replaces the stock turbocharger(s) with larger, more efficient units that can provide more boost pressure and move more air. In some cases, conversion to a supercharger might be an option for specific engine platforms.


Benefits:
Massive potential for horsepower and torque gains. Can provide a broader powerband and more immediate boost response depending on the turbo chosen.

Complexity: This is a significant modification that often requires supporting modifications.


Supporting Mods: Larger intercoolers (to cool the compressed air), upgraded fuel injectors, a stronger fuel pump, and robust ECU tuning are almost always necessary.

Installation: Requires substantial mechanical knowledge and often specialized tools.


Beginner Friendliness: Not recommended for beginners. This is an advanced modification best left to experienced tuners and mechanics.

Cost: This is typically one of the most expensive performance upgrade paths.

DIY vs. Professional Installation

DIY vs. Professional Installation

Many performance upgrades can be tackled by a motivated DIYer with basic tools and mechanical aptitude. Simple items like air filters, exhaust tips, or even full cat-back exhaust systems can often be installed in a weekend. However, as you move into more complex modifications like downpipes, headers, turbochargers, or full suspension overhauls, the need for specialized tools, a lift, and expert knowledge becomes paramount.

 

For ECU tuning, while handheld tuners are plug-and-play, achieving optimal and safe results, especially for advanced setups, is best done by a professional tuner on a dynamometer. Incorrect tuning can lead to severe engine damage. Always assess your skills honestly before undertaking a DIY installation for performance parts. If in doubt, consult a reputable Mercedes-Benz specialist or performance shop.

Maintaining Performance After Upgrades

Maintaining Performance After Upgrades

Once you’ve upgraded your R-Class, a slightly more attentive maintenance schedule is recommended.

 

Fluid Changes: Use high-quality, appropriate synthetic oils and fluids. Consider more frequent oil changes, especially if you’re driving the car aggressively or have performed significant engine tuning.


Check for Leaks: After installing exhaust or intake components, regularly check for any exhaust leaks or vacuum leaks, as these can negatively impact performance and driveability.

Inspect Components: Periodically inspect upgraded components, such as brake pads, rotors, and suspension bushings, for wear.


Monitor Engine Health: Pay attention to any new noises, vibrations, or warning lights. Modern diagnostic tools can help identify issues early.
